How to Make Money With Video Editing: 10 Ideas

How to Make Money With Video Editing: 10 Ideas

With so many people creating content for YouTube, TikTok, Instagram and more, there is a huge demand for editors who can take raw footage and turn it into professional videos.

If you want to start a full-time business or make some money on the side, video editing offers a lot of options.

In this article, we'll cover 10 ways to make money with video editing skills. From editing for social media influencers to creating stock footage, you can choose the ideas that best fit your interests, skills and schedule.

1. Start a YouTube Channel

One of the best ways to make money from video editing is to start your own YouTube channel. By creating entertaining or informative videos, you can build an audience and monetize your content.

When starting a YouTube channel, pick a specific niche or topic you're passionate about. Make videos that provide value to viewers. Use your video editing skills to make high-quality content that keeps your audience engaged throughout the video, even with their short attention spans.

Use catchy graphics, create cliffhangers and do whatever it takes to keep viewers watching. The longer they watch your videos, the more ads they'll see, earning you higher revenue.

Once you have 1,000 subscribers and 4,000 watch hours (or 10M short views), you can apply for YouTube Partner status. This will allow you to monetize your channel through ads, YouTube Premium revenue, channel memberships, merchandise and more.

2. Edit TikTok Videos for Clients

TikTok is the perfect platform to find video editing clients. Millions of creators are making content but need help optimizing it. Stand out by offering your editing services directly to TikTokers.

Start by creating your own TikTok showcasing popular editing techniques like quick cuts, text overlays, emojis and other trending visual effects. This demonstrates your skills.

3. Start a Course on Video Editing

Teaching others is a great way to monetize your editing expertise. Creating an online video course allows you to earn passive income while making an impact sharing your knowledge.

Start by outlining the key topics and skills you want to cover, from video editing basics to advanced techniques and trends. Structure the material into organized lessons and modules.

You can upload your course to platforms like Udemy, Skillshare or your own website.

4. Offer Your Service on Freelancing Sites

Freelancing sites like Upwork and Fiverr are great platforms for offering your video editing services to a wide audience.

Start by creating detailed profiles showcasing your skills, experience and portfolio. Offer packages for different types of projects, from basic editing to animation and visual effects.

As you gain 5-star ratings, you’ll appear higher in search results, bringing you more business. Take advantage of site features like skills tests and targeting several languages to stand out and get found faster.

5. Edit Music Videos

Offering music video editing services is a great way to build your portfolio while getting paid. Start by reaching out directly to independent musicians in your area.

Offer very affordable rates on music video projects for your clients. This makes you an appealing option for artists on a budget.

Show them examples of techniques like perfectly timed cuts, visual effects, transitions and text/lyrics integration.

As you complete more music videos, your portfolio will expand, allowing you to increase your rates and attract more clients.

6. Create Promotional Videos

Businesses are always looking for video content to promote their products, services and brand. As an editor, you can help fill this need by creating professional commercials, explainer videos, product demos and more.

Use your technical skills to edit eye-catching marketing videos tailored to each company.

Consider implementing animations, graphics, special effects and dynamic edits to make the content engaging.

Having a diverse promotional video editing portfolio will enable you to effectively pitch your services to businesses for paid projects. Start by offering discounted rates to build relationships and gain references.

7. Edit Real Estate Videos

Real estate agents and property managers regularly need high-quality video content to market listings and promote their services. This presents an excellent opportunity to offer your video editing skills.

Reach out to agents directly through email or cold calls. Offer to edit or enhance their property listing videos at a reasonable rate.

The good thing about this video editing niche is that there is a lot of money flowing in this business model. Real estate agents work with large amounts of money, so this is the perfect way to profit from that.

8. Film and Edit for Local Businesses

You can start a profitable side hustle by offering end-to-end video production to local businesses. This includes filming original footage based on their needs and brand, as well as editing it into polished content.

Show them examples of videos you’ve made for other brands. Explain how you can conduct any required interviews or B-roll shooting, then edit it together with graphics, music, etc. to match the results they’re looking for.

9. Edit for YouTube Channels

Offering your editing services to YouTubers is a win-win. You get paid to edit videos, while they get professionally edited content that helps grow their channel.

Search for smaller but serious YouTube channels in your niche. Reach out explaining you're building your video editing portfolio and offer discounted editing services.

It might also be worth joining a few freelancing discords and offering your service as there is a lot of demand for this among YouTubers.

10. Create Stock Footage

An often overlooked way to profit from video editing skills is selling stock footage. Stock videos of backgrounds, nature, cityscapes, events and constantly being purchased by a large audience.

Edit clips into clean, seamless footage optimized for stock sales. Upload to stock marketplaces like Adobe Stock or Shutterstock. Tag and title clips thoroughly so they surface in searches.

FAQs

How much money can you make with video editing?

The amount of money you can make with video editing varies widely depending on your skills, niche and target audience. Beginners can earn $15-25 per hour, while experienced professionals charge up to $180 per hour.

How do I promote my video editing business?

To promote your video editing business, create an online portfolio to showcase your best work. Use social media by posting examples and engaging with potential clients. It is suggested to offer free or discounted edits at first to build trust.

What is the best free video editing software?

The best free editing programs are DaVinci Resolve, Hitfilm Express and CapCut. Invest time learning the software deeply rather than jumping around. A skilled editor can create great work with free tools.

How long does it take to learn video editing?

It takes most people 1-2 months of regular practice to go from a beginner to an intermediate editor capable of high-quality client work. Study training courses, read editing blogs, watch tutorials and keep creating your own projects. You’ll see large improvements in skills within months of dedicated practice.
